Now, onto the history and address of the museum. The Danish Design Museum has been around since 1890, can you believe it? They started off as a collection of plaster casts and replicas, but soon turned into a design museum in 1926. Their address is Bredgade 68, 1260 København K, Denmark.

Q: Is photography allowed in the museum?

A: Yes, but only without flash.

Q: What are the opening hours?

A: The museum is open from Tuesday to Sunday, from 11: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m.

Q: How much does it cost to enter the museum?

A: It's free for children under the age of 18, and for everyone else, it's 100 DKK (Danish Krone), which is approximately 16 USD.

Q: Is there a gift shop?

A: Yes, there is a gift shop where you can purchase unique and well-designed souvenirs.
